Description
Boys and Girls Clubs of Greater Northwest Indiana inspires and enables the youth of our communities to reach their full potential as productive, responsible, and caring citizens. In 2020, we provided a safe place for more than 11,000 kindergarten through high school aged children to participate in programs during non-school hours and summer months. Our diversified programs offer various opportunities for growth and development.

Program areas at Boys and Girls Clubs of Greater Northwest Indiana

In 2023, Boys & Girls Clubs of Greater Northwest Indiana, Inc. Provided a safe place for more than five thousand kindergartens through high school aged children to participate in programs during non-school hours and summer months. We offer diversified programs at eleven facilities and an additional kidstop child care program for before and after school care at nine porter county school sites. We offer programs in five core areas: education and career development; fitness, sports and recreation; the arts; character and leadership; and health and life skills. While they are separate in many ways, they add up to the most essential outcome of all: young people who are prepared to enter the adult world as productive, responsible, caring citizens.
